Frequently Asked Questions

Who is this golf school for?

Golfers who want to play better without pain, confusion, or mechanics that don’t match their body.

What if it rains?

We train rain or shine. Covered hitting areas are available. In extreme weather, we'll reschedule.

Is this good for beginners?

It’s best for experienced recreational golfers who play at least occasionally.

Who will be coaching?

Andrew Emery leads all schools. He is supported by Pete Skirpstas, former Tour player and our Director of Operations at Andrew Emery Golf.

What makes this different?

We teach feel-based coaching designed to help you sense and trust your swing. No over-technical instruction.

Can I attend with a friend or spouse?

Absolutely. Our couple’s rate gives you $495 off and it’s a great shared experience.

Will I receive a video analysis?

Yes. Each participant gets personalized swing video breakdowns and written tuition notes.

What should I bring?

Bring your clubs, glove, weather-appropriate clothing, and golf shoes. Balls and tees provided.

Is lodging included?

No. You’re responsible for booking your own hotel. See options below.

Where should I stay?

West Ashley (15–20 mins): Home2 Suites, Holiday Inn Express

Downtown Charleston (30–35 mins): The Palmetto Hotel, Charleston Place, The Ryder Hotel

What’s the refund/cancellation policy?

Full refunds available up to 14 days prior to your school date. Within 14 days, you may transfer to a future school.
